Overview

The Master of Landscape Architecture degree is a graduate-level program that focuses on the design, planning and management of outdoor spaces. This degree program is ideal for individuals who are interested in creating sustainable and functional outdoor environments that are aesthetically pleasing.

Curriculum Overview by Year

  • First Year: Introduction to Landscape Architecture, Site Analysis and Planning, Landscape Design Studio, Planting Design, History and Theory of Landscape Architecture
  • Second Year: Advanced Landscape Design Studio, Landscape Ecology, Landscape Construction, Professional Practice, Electives
  • Third Year (optional): Thesis or Capstone Project

Key Components

  • Design and Planning: Students learn how to create functional and aesthetically pleasing outdoor spaces that meet the needs of the community.
  • Sustainability: Students learn how to design landscapes that are environmentally sustainable and promote biodiversity.
  • Technology: Students learn how to use the latest technology and software to create and present their designs.
  • Professional Practice: Students learn about the business side of landscape architecture, including project management, budgeting and client relations.

Career Prospects

Graduates of the Master of Landscape Architecture program can pursue a variety of careers, including:

  • Landscape Architect
  • Urban Designer
  • Environmental Planner
  • Park Ranger
  • Green Infrastructure Specialist

Salary Expectations

The salary for graduates of the Master of Landscape Architecture program can vary depending on the job title, location and years of experience.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for landscape architects was $73,160 in May 2020.
